ED Conducts Raids in Money Laundering Probe Involving Veena Vijayan and CMRL

Analysed 19 Aug 2026·11 sources analysed·Kerala, India·Crime
ED Conducts Raids in Money Laundering Probe Involving Veena Vijayan and CMRLPreviousNext

The Enforcement Directorate (ED) conducted raids at multiple locations in Kozhikode linked to a money laundering probe involving Cochin Minerals and Rutile Limited (CMRL) and Exalogic Solutions, a defunct firm owned by Veena T, daughter of former Kerala CM Pinarayi Vijayan. The ED alleges fraudulent payments totaling Rs 2.78 crore without services rendered and uncovered handwritten notes detailing transactions, including Rs 85 lakh transferred to Dubai via hawala channels. Veena and associates deny wrongdoing, while opposition parties demand further investigation. The probe continues amid political tensions and legal challenges.
